PCI/VGA: Factor out vga_select_framebuffer_device()

On x86 and ia64, if a VGA device BARs include a framebuffer reported by
platform firmware, we select the device as the default VGA device.  Factor
this code to a separate function.  No functional change intended.

static void __init vga_select_framebuffer_device(struct pci_dev *pdev)
{
#if defined(CONFIG_X86) || defined(CONFIG_IA64)
struct device *dev = &pdev->dev;
u64 base = screen_info.lfb_base;
u64 size = screen_info.lfb_size;
u64 limit;
resource_size_t start, end;
unsigned long flags;
int i;
/* Select the device owning the boot framebuffer if there is one */
if (screen_info.capabilities & VIDEO_CAPABILITY_64BIT_BASE)
base |= (u64)screen_info.ext_lfb_base << 32;
limit = base + size;
/*
* Override vga_arbiter_add_pci_device()'s I/O based detection
* as it may take the wrong device (e.g. on Apple system under
* EFI).
*
* Select the device owning the boot framebuffer if there is
* one.
*/
/* Does firmware framebuffer belong to us? */
for (i = 0; i < DEVICE_COUNT_RESOURCE; i++) {
flags = pci_resource_flags(pdev, i);
if ((flags & IORESOURCE_MEM) == 0)
continue;
start = pci_resource_start(pdev, i);
end = pci_resource_end(pdev, i);
if (!start || !end)
continue;
if (base < start || limit >= end)
continue;
if (!vga_default_device())
vgaarb_info(dev, "setting as boot device\n");
else if (pdev != vga_default_device())
vgaarb_info(dev, "overriding boot device\n");
vga_set_default_device(pdev);
}
#endif
}
